Rhubarb Chips


I wanted to make some rhubarb chips that I could add to my cottage cheese and such in the mornings.

Ingredients:

Some rhubarb. 
Some artificial sweetener. 

Instructions:

Chop the rhubarb into tiny little cubes. 
Mix it up with the artificial sweetener, to taste. I recommend a Tupperware type thing with the lid, and shake it up. 
Spread it out on a tray in the dehydrator.
Dehydrate it for a couple of days.
Store it in a glass jar until you're ready to use it.
 it turns out that the artificial sweetener that you use makes a noticeable difference.

The one on the left, the darker one, used the sucralose sweetener. The result is a darker fruit, and more of the rhubarb taste. The one on the right uses a mix of ethritol and monk fruit. The color is lighter, and the rhubarb flavor is lighter , almost hidden underneath the sweetener.

Either way, Per serving, that’s about 6.4 calories, 4.4 g total carbs, 0.6 g fiber, 3.8 g net carbs, 0.3 g sugar, 0.3 g protein, and 0.1 g fat.
